Exactly how to Select the very best Solar Installers in Danville for Your Home

Going solar looks straightforward from a distance. A couple of panels on the roof covering, a reduced electric expense, maybe a backup battery in the garage, and you are done. The fact is much more nuanced. The high quality of the installer shapes nearly everything that complies with, from system performance and allow timelines to the problem of your roofing and the simplicity of getting service 3 years later.
Homeowners in Danville typically begin similarly, by inputting expressions like solar installers Danville, solar installers near me, or solar installment firms near me into a search bar and comparing whichever names appear initially. That is reasonable, but search positions and paid advertisements do not tell you exactly how carefully a company takes care of style, whether the staff secures floor tile roofings effectively, or how they react when an inverter tosses a mistake code in July.
Choosing the best installer is not just about locating the most affordable quote. It has to do with locating the company that can develop the best system for your house, explain the compromises truthfully, mount it easily, and guarantee the job long after the sales contract is signed.
Why regional judgment issues in Danville
Danville is not a one-size-fits-all solar market. The real estate stock differs. Some homes have extensive south-facing roofing airplanes with plenty of room. Others take care of fully grown trees, intricate roofing lines, HOA concerns, or roofing systems that are nearing the end of their life. Microclimates matter also. A system that looks excellent theoretically can underperform if the installer does not account for repeating afternoon color, particles build-up, or seasonal sunlight angles.
A neighborhood contractor with strong experience in solar setup Danville projects generally comprehends these details better than an out-of-area sales company that subcontracts every action. They know the common allowing assumptions, the energy affiliation rhythm, and the kinds of roofings they see usually in the area. That sort of knowledge frequently stops hold-ups and expensive rework.
It also assists when a person can stroll the home and talk with actual constraints. I have actually seen homeowners get passionate proposals https://privatebin.net/?726f2166b50ea863#z9gQUU8ezitysDf52trbeVox2oRXZ4d3EeqZsFmtp6Z that guaranteed near-perfect production numbers, just to find out later that a chimney shadow clipped result every afternoon. A cautious installer captures that during site evaluation, not after the panels are already on the roof.
Start with your home, not the sales pitch
Before you compare firms, get clear regarding your very own home and your objectives. Solar is not the exact same acquisition for every single family members. One house desires the shortest repayment possible and is great taking full advantage of roofing system area. One more cares even more concerning visual appeals and just desires the front roofing unblemished. A 3rd strategies to purchase an electric lorry within a year and requires a system that can support higher consumption later.
A beneficial conversation with any kind of installer ought to cover your current yearly electrical power use, likely future adjustments, roofing system age, panel positioning choices, and whether you desire battery storage. If a salesperson leaps straight to funding alternatives without spending quality time on those basics, that is usually a sign that the proposition is being driven by a quota rather than by your home.
Roof problem is especially crucial. If your roofing has only a few years left, solar installation can end up being a lot more pricey over time since you might need to eliminate and reinstall the system for reroofing. Excellent installers elevate this issue early, even when it risks reducing the sale. That honesty is worth a terrific deal.
What divides a solid installer from a weak one
Most homeowners can not evaluate circuitry craftsmanship from a proposition package. What you can examine is procedure, transparency, and technical depth.
A solid installer normally asks much better inquiries than a weak one. They want copies of current electrical costs. They ask whether your circuit box has enough capacity. They consider roof covering type, age, pitch, attic room accessibility, and shade sources. If battery storage space belongs to the conversation, they discuss which loads you really want backed up. A/c, refrigeration, net equipment, and lighting all have different ramifications for battery sizing.
They also explain style selections clearly. Why this panel rather than that a person? Why microinverters versus a string inverter? Why position components on two roof covering airplanes as opposed to one? You do not need a lecture, however you do require reasoning. When an installer can clarify trade-offs in ordinary language, it usually indicates the system has been thought through.
Weak installers tend to seem smooth yet obscure. They lean on phrases like "premium bundle" without defining what makes it premium. They provide a production estimate yet can not describe the assumptions behind it. They may price estimate boldy low cost by overlooking electric upgrades, attic avenue job, usage surveillance, or primary panel changes that later appear as adjustment orders.
Licenses, insurance policy, and who really does the work
This is where numerous house owners obtain tripped up. The business name on the proposition is not always the company that will certainly get on your roof.
Some firms sell the job and subcontract setup. That is not immediately poor, but you require clarity. Ask that holds the relevant certificate, that pulls permits, who oversees the staff, and that handles warranty telephone calls. If several parties are entailed, you desire the chain of obligation in writing.
You needs to also validate insurance policy protection. Roof covering work, electric work, and ladder job bring actual threats. A reputable firm must have no concern supplying evidence of basic liability and workers' payment insurance coverage. If the action really feels evasive, move on.
Certifications can be beneficial signals, however they are not a substitute for execution. A business can have great logos on its web site and still run careless work. Deal with qualifications as one data point, not the final answer.
What a detailed site assessment should look like
The best solar assessments really feel practical. Somebody examines your actual residence instead of counting only on satellite images and a common software program layout.
A correct website testimonial often consists of roof measurements, shade analysis, electrical panel evaluation, conversation of attic or conduit transmitting, and a discussion regarding solution upgrades if your existing tools is older. On ceramic tile roofs, the installer ought to explain how add-ons will certainly be managed and just how broken floor tiles, if any kind of, are addressed. On make-up tile roofing systems, they should discuss blinking approaches and roof penetrations in a manner that influences confidence, not anxiety.
This is additionally the stage where information concerning battery placement, garage wall surface space, clearances, and air flow ought to turn up if storage space is part of the strategy. These are not glamorous subjects, however they are precisely the important things that determine whether a job runs smoothly.
One home owner I consulted with had 3 proposals within a week. 2 were similar on price. The cheaper-looking one never ever sent out any person to inspect the electrical panel prior to pricing quote. The even more cautious business did, discovered that the panel plan would likely need extra work, and valued that reality in from the beginning. The very first quote looked better up until it ended up being apparent that it was incomplete.
Reading propositions without obtaining lost in marketing
Solar proposals can be glossy and still be hard to compare. Strip them down to the essentials. You need to know system dimension in kilowatts, approximated yearly manufacturing, panel brand and model, inverter type, mounting approach, included electric job, keeping track of attributes, service warranty terms, timeline assumptions, and complete installed cost.
Do not let any individual thrill you past the production estimate. A system's worth depends on outcome, not simply on panel count. 2 proposals can both provide a 7-kilowatt system while differing meaningfully in expected yearly generation as a result of panel placement, tools choices, or shade assumptions.
If one company asserts drastically greater manufacturing than the others, ask why. Often they have actually determined a much better layout. Occasionally they are merely utilizing optimistic assumptions. A good installer can protect the quote in such a way that makes technical and functional sense.
Financing should have the same analysis. Some lendings look attractive since they reduced month-to-month settlements, yet dealership costs and long-term can increase the complete cost materially. Cash money pricing, loan pricing, and any kind of assumptions about tax credit ratings ought to be divided plainly. If the quote really feels engineered to keep your focus on the monthly repayment alone, reduce and check out the fine print.
The concerns worth asking prior to you sign
A short, straight set of concerns can disclose a whole lot about an installer's professionalism:
- Who will certainly do the installment, your staff members or a subcontractor?
- What roof covering, electrical, and checking parts are consisted of in the quoted price?
- How do you manage solution phone calls, and what response time should I expect?
- What workmanship service warranty do you offer, and that honors manufacturer warranties?
- What assumptions did you utilize for yearly manufacturing and future utility price changes?
You do not require best responses, yet you do need clear ones. Confident, thorough feedbacks usually signal a business that has done this lot of times and knows where jobs can go sideways.
Price issues, but affordable solar can get expensive
Everyone desires a reasonable offer. There is absolutely nothing incorrect with discussing. Still, the lowest proposal is commonly low for a factor. Sometimes that reason is easy efficiency and reasonable margins. Sometimes it is because important job has been left out, lower-tier devices is being utilized, or support after installation is minimal.
Think about the total possession experience. If the crew damages roofing materials, if conduit runs are sloppy, if licenses stall because the plans were insufficient, or if you can not obtain any person on the phone after appointing, any kind of first cost savings vaporize quickly.
The opposite holds true also. One of the most expensive proposal is not immediately the best. Some premium-priced companies deserve it due to the fact that they provide meticulous layout, strong job administration, and superb support. Others simply invest more on advertising and sales overhead. Price should be judged against extent, workmanship, and reputation, not in isolation.
In Danville, visual appeals frequently matter greater than in some other markets. A thoughtful layout, hidden channel where possible, and cleaner roofing system lines can validate a rather higher cost if aesthetic appeal is necessary to you. That may disappoint up nicely in a payback spreadsheet, however it absolutely matters to many homeowners.
Reviews serve, but only if you review them intelligently
Online evaluations can aid, yet celebrity scores alone are also candid. Check out the center testimonials, not just the glowing ones or the angry one-star blog posts. Seek patterns. If several house owners state bad interaction during allowing, that is most likely actual. If multiple testimonials applaud the exact same task manager or solution team by name, that is likewise meaningful.
Pay attention to what happened after setup. Did the firm respond when checking went offline? Were punch-list items took care of quickly? Did the home owner feel notified during the process? Solar is a system that ought to last decades, so support matters.
It is also wise to request a couple of recent local references. Not curated reviews on a pamphlet, actual customers whose jobs are similar to yours. A homeowner with a similar roof covering type and system dimension can typically inform you much more in ten mins than a refined sales deck can in an hour.

Batteries, backup power, and future flexibility
Battery storage space is no longer a fringe alternative, however it is still not the appropriate option for every single home. Some homes care mainly regarding expense cost savings and can defer storage. Others desire resiliency throughout blackouts and are willing to pay for it. The appropriate installer ought to aid you think through that choice carefully.
Battery discussions must specify. Which circuits will be supported? For for how long, under what use presumptions? Will the battery assistance central air conditioning, or selected lots? Can the system be increased later? Those questions matter greater than broad insurance claims concerning "energy independence."
Future versatility deserves discussing also if you do not set up a battery today. If you anticipate to add an EV battery charger, heat pump, swimming pool devices, or an induction array, those modifications can reshape your electrical power needs. A thoughtful installer might suggest leaving room for growth, upsizing certain electric parts, or choosing devices that integrates easily later.
The function of service warranties, and what they do not cover
Solar customers usually find out about 25-year panel warranties and assume that everything is protected for years. The reality is more layered. There are normally item service warranties, efficiency guarantees, and handiwork service warranties, and they cover different things.
The installer's handiwork service warranty is the one numerous house owners should examine most carefully. That is what talks to roof covering infiltrations, setup errors, and labor for fixing particular issues. Producer service warranties matter also, specifically for inverters and batteries, however you need to know who coordinates replacement and labor if something fails.
Ask just how service warranty service really works. If an inverter decreases, do you call the installer first? Will they identify from another location? Is labor included? What takes place if the maker accepts a substitute however the installer bills a see charge? Those useful details matter far more than a flashy guarantee page in a brochure.
How long the procedure generally takes
Homeowners commonly underestimate timeline variability. A solar job actions through sales, design, engineering, allowing, utility authorization, setup, inspection, and approval to run. Some actions move promptly. Others do not.
A straightforward project can move from signed contract to operation within a couple of months, while a lot more complex jobs can take longer, especially if a major panel upgrade, reroofing coordination, battery permitting, or utility documents includes rubbing. An experienced business will certainly not assure an unrealistically quick timeline just to win the job. Instead, they will certainly describe what is under their control and what is not.
That honesty issues since communication tends to form the customer experience more than rate alone. Many property owners are patient if they recognize the procedure. They obtain frustrated when weeks pass without updates.
Choosing in between a nationwide brand name and a solid regional company
There is no universal champion here. Large local or national firms may use recognizable branding, broad funding alternatives, and standard procedures. Strong neighborhood companies commonly supply extra straight interaction, far better connection, and staffs that recognize the location well.
The making a decision factor is not company size. It is whether the business is arranged, practically competent, and liable. I have seen excellent small operators and unpleasant big ones, and the reverse as well. Contrast them on the fundamentals: design quality, extent clearness, responsiveness, referrals, and post-install support.

What does the average solar installation cost in Danville?
The average residential solar installation typically costs between $15,000 and $30,000 before incentives. Final pricing depends on system size, equipment quality, roof characteristics, and installation complexity. Federal tax credits and other incentives can reduce the upfront expense. Larger systems generally have higher installation costs.
What appliances cannot be used with solar power in Danville?
Most household appliances can operate using solar power if the system is properly sized. High-energy appliances such as electric heating systems, central air conditioners, and electric water heaters may require a larger solar array or battery storage. The limitation is usually available electricity rather than the appliance itself. Matching energy demand with system capacity is important.

Why is my electric bill high if I have solar in Danville?
Your electric bill may remain high if your solar system does not generate enough electricity to offset your energy use. Increased electricity consumption, seasonal weather, utility charges, or reduced system performance can all contribute. Shading, dirty panels, or equipment issues may also lower energy production. Reviewing both energy usage and solar output can help identify the cause.
Can AC run on solar panels in Danville?
Yes, an air conditioner can run on electricity generated by solar panels when the system is properly sized. Solar production is typically highest during sunny periods when cooling demand is also greater. Battery storage or grid electricity can provide additional power when solar production decreases. Energy-efficient air conditioners can reduce overall electricity consumption.
Do solar panels work in winter in Danville?
Yes, solar panels continue producing electricity during winter whenever sunlight is available. Shorter days and cloud cover usually reduce total energy production compared to summer. Cold temperatures can improve panel efficiency under clear conditions. Keeping panels free of debris helps maintain performance.
